Primary care nurse leadership programme
Applications are open for the Rosalind Franklin Leadership Programme for nurses working in primary care.
The course is run by the NHS Leadership Academy and places are fully funded as part of the GP Nursing 10 Point Plan. It aims to develop middle-level nursing leaders into outstanding leaders who will be better equipped to improve health outcomes and patient experience within primary care.
Participants will attend 11.5 days of external training over 10 months and undertake around five hours per week of additional study.
